President , i rise today to celebrate the passage of the Great American outdoors act. The passage of this historic legislation marks a once in a generation step by this body to restore and conserve our National Parks as well as our countrys national heritage. It builds on an american tradition of conserving our natural wonders and shared public spaces. It reaffirms our commitment to preserve if for future generations. Its also important to note that this is a jobs bill. According to a recent study, the Great American outdoors act will help create or support 100,000 jobs all over the country, including 10,000 in my home state of virginia at a time when millions of americans are out of work. Shenandoah County preparing to mitigate Spongy Moths

Shenandoah County is working to form a partnership with the U.S. Forest Service to attempt to mitigate the Spongy Moth population in the Northern Shenandoah Valley. These insects also known as Gypsy Moths can cause big problems in the local ecosystem.
